"He felt sorry for what he had done" vs "He felt sorry about what he had done"

Both phrases are correct, but they are used in slightly different contexts. 'He felt sorry about what he had done' is used when expressing regret or remorse for a specific action or event. On the other hand, 'He felt sorry for what he had done' is used when feeling compassion or sympathy towards oneself for a particular action or event.

He felt sorry for what he had done

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express feeling compassion or sympathy towards oneself for a particular action or event.

Examples:

  • He felt sorry for what he had said to her.
  • She felt sorry for the way she had treated him.
  • They felt sorry for the mistake they had made.
  • I feel sorry for what I did yesterday.
  • He feels sorry for the accident he caused.

He felt sorry about what he had done

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express regret or remorse for a specific action or event.

Examples:

  • He felt sorry about what he had said to her.
  • She felt sorry about the way she had treated him.
  • They felt sorry about the mistake they had made.
  • I feel sorry about what I did yesterday.
  • He feels sorry about the accident he caused.

Alternatives:

  • he regretted what he had done
  • he was remorseful about what he had done
  • he was apologetic for what he had done
  • he felt bad about what he had done
  • he was contrite about what he had done
